INDOOR AIR QUALITY TESTING SERVICE MARKET OVERVIEW
The Indoor Air Quality Testing Service Market, valued at USD 0.7 billion in 2024, is forecasted to grow consistently, reaching USD 0.74 billion in 2025 and ultimately hitting USD 1.14 billion by 2033, at a steady CAGR of 5.6% from 2025 to 2033.
Indoor air quality testing service(IAQ) is a critical process for determining the level of contaminants present in indoor air, which can affect occupant productivity and well-being. Good and healthy air quality in the workplace can improve employee comfort, productivity, and well-being. Perfect Pollucon Services inspects indoor air quality testing service equipment for various harmful parameters in homes and businesses. Regular indoor air quality testing service can assist in identifying air quality issues. Every year, thousands of man-days are lost due to illness caused by poor indoor air quality.
Indoor air quality testing (IAQ) can have a significant impact on the health, well-being, and productivity of building occupants. Poor IAQ, whether in a hospital, hotel, corporate office, school, commercial, or institutional building, can be hazardous to workers' health, and you must also meet regulatory compliance. This is why it is critical to have pre-monitoring and testing of indoor air after construction and before relocating your workforce.

Increasing Pollutants to Fuel Market Growth
As the COVID-19 pandemic has confined people to their homes or other enclosed spaces, the need to improve indoor air quality has grown. People learned more about the tools and technologies available for providing controlled indoor air quality. Indoor air pollution is becoming more prevalent, causing health problems such as eye, nose, and throat irritation, headaches, dizziness, and fatigue, as well as respiratory diseases, heart disease, and cancer. Asthma is triggered by a variety of indoor air pollutants, including dust mites, mold, pet dander, environmental tobacco smoke, cockroach allergens, particulate matter, and others. Such negative effects of indoor air pollution have increased the demand for improved air quality through the use of indoor air quality monitoring systems. As a result, all of these factors promote and raise awareness among people, resulting in market growth.

- Nexgen (U.S.): Nexgen offers comprehensive indoor air quality testing services, including assessments for volatile organic compounds (VOCs), mold, and carbon monoxide, utilizing licensed professionals to ensure accurate results.
- ALS (Australia): ALS is a leading provider of ambient and indoor air quality testing services, offering tailored analyte packages and sampling media for various target compounds, supported by accredited laboratories following national and international standards.
